Uganda has one of the highest rates of child malnutrition and undernutrition of the African nations.

At Mweruka Junior School, food isn’t just a meal—it’s a ministry of hope, health, and opportunity. For many of our students, school lunch is their most reliable meal of the day. Without it, hunger would stand in the way of learning.

That’s why the Blessings of Joy Nutrition Fund exists: to ensure every child receives nutritious meals that fuel both body and mind.

Each morning, students receive warm porridge made from maize, soya, and milk boosters. On Fridays, attendance is always highest—because that’s when the cooks serve stew with Irish potatoes, beans, vegetables, and even silverfish. Seasonal fruits like pineapple and watermelon round out the meal, and vitamins and deworming medication are provided each trimester to support whole-body health.

A community garden supplements the school’s supply, and Blessings of Joy provides beans and rice to vulnerable families through sponsorship support. Since the program began, teachers report more energy, better focus, fewer illnesses, and brighter smiles.
